Hi All, This is not a fix, it just reduces race probability because file descriptor will be opened later. I normal environment issue is not likely to happen because user doesn't create and stop arrays in loop. Issue here should be resolved in tests, perhaps wait should be sufficient. I tried to resolve it in the past by adding completion to md driver and force mdadm --stop command to wait for sysfs clean up but I have never finished it. IMO it is a better way, wait for device to be fully removed by MD during stop. Thoughts? One objection I have here is that error handling is changed, so it could be harmful change for users. > > > > Side note: it would be nice to disable create_on_open as well to help > > solve this, but it seems the work for this was never finished. I'm slowly working on this. The change is not simple, starting from terrible create_mddev code and char *mddev and char *name rules , ending with hidden references which we are not aware off (it is common to create temp node and open mddevice in mdadm) and other references in systemd (because of that, udev is avoiding to open device). This also indicate that we should drop partition discover in kernel and use udev in the future, especially for external metadata (where RO -> RW transition happens during assembly). But this is a separate problem.
